Grasping PAR & PPFD in Grow Light Measurement

When it comes to cultivating plants indoors, understanding the terminology of grow lights is essential. Two key measurements you'll often encounter are PAR and PPFD. PAR stands for Photosynthetically Active Radiation, signifying the portion of light that plants can actually use for photosynthesis. PPFD, on the other hand, is measured as Photosynthetic Photon Flux Density, which is the number of light energy captured by a given area over time.

By understanding these values, you can maximize your grow lights to supply the ideal lighting conditions for your cultivations. This can lead to stronger plants and a more productive grow.

  • Factors such as range from the light source, spectrum of light, and duration of exposure all affect both PAR and PPFD levels.
  • Many grow lights include information about their PAR and PPFD output in the product details .
